Challenger

Challenger is a high-performing, large-fruited hybrid pumpkin. Maturing in around 100 days, it produces deep orange fruits with pronounced ribbing and a long, thick green handle. Plants have a reduced vine habit and display a high level of resistance to Powdery and Downy Mildew, ensuring excellent fruit quality even in challenging late-season conditions. Average yield is two sizeable pumpkins per plant, each weighing between 10 – 12 kg (22–27 lb).
